Fischer Elektronik has extended its professional tube case system by a second version in square design and with IP54 protection. This rugged case is the 'big brother' of TUG05 with its innovative use of aluminium profile, high stability and excellent cooling properties. Seventeen height levels arranged at a modular spacing of 5,08 mm are provided for horizontal accommodation of Euro cards to DIN 41494. In the vertical direction, a maximum of two cards may be inserted.
It should be noted that the fastening straps for wall mounting (accessories) can be fixed without screws, but the case can also be used as a desk case.
The case is supplied with a natural or black anodised surface finish. The electric-conductive version has a transparent or a yellow chromated surface. Subsequent painting is possible (EMC/ESD).
